Spotlight: Coe College
The Coe College archive contains a wide variety of content, including yearbooks from 1903-2007 and newspapers from 1899-2013. Coe College was founded by Presbyterian minister Williston Jones in 1851. Spotlight: The Stark County Genealogical Society in Toulon, IL
The Stark County Genealogical Society The Stark County Genealogical Society’s Community History Archive features The Stark County News (from 1857-1984 and from 2002-2009) the Stark County Union published in 1882, and The Prairie Times published in LaFayette, Illinois, from 1987-2000.
